What is a full time PCQI?

Full Time PCQI jobs refer to positions where an individual serves as a Preventive Controls Qualified Individual (PCQI) on a full-time basis. A PCQI is responsible for developing, implementing, and overseeing food safety plans in compliance with the Food Safety Modernization Act (FSMA), specifically the Preventive Controls for Human Food rule. These roles are typically found in food manufacturing, processing, or packaging companies. The PCQI ensures that food safety programs are up to date, records are properly maintained, and that the facility adheres to regulatory standards. Full-time positions require a thorough understanding of food safety regulations and often involve staff training and internal audits.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a full time PCQI?

To thrive as a Full Time PCQI, you need in-depth knowledge of food safety regulations, preventive controls, and typically a relevant degree in food science or a related field, along with PCQI certification. Familiarity with HACCP plans, FSMA requirements, and audit management systems is crucial. Str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and effective communication set outstanding candidates apart. These competencies ensure compliance, reduce food safety risks, and support continuous improvement in food manufacturing environments.

What are some common challenges a full time PCQI faces in maintaining compliance with FSMA regulations?

A full-time PCQI often encounters challenges such as keeping up with evolving FSMA (Food Safety Modernization Act) regulations, ensuring all team members adhere to preventive controls, and maintaining thorough documentation for audits. Coordinating training across different shifts and departments to ensure everyone understands critical control points can be demanding. Additionally, managing corrective actions promptly and effectively, especially after non-conformances or recalls, requires strong communication and leadership skills to foster a robust food safety culture.

What is the difference between Full Time Pcqi vs Full Time Quality Control Inspector?

AspectFull Time PcqiFull Time Quality Control Inspector
CertificationsPCQI certification requiredTypically requires QC-related certifications
Work EnvironmentFood manufacturing, processing facilitiesManufacturing, production lines, quality labs
Employer & IndustryFood industry, regulatory complianceManufacturing plants, quality assurance
Job FocusPreventive controls, HACCP complianceInspection, sampling, quality verification

Full Time Pcqi professionals focus on implementing and maintaining food safety preventive controls, ensuring compliance with regulations. In contrast, Full Time Quality Control Inspectors primarily perform inspections and sampling to verify product quality. Both roles are essential in manufacturing but differ in scope and responsibilities.
